Imagine having $60 million dollars and giving every cent of it away. That's what Milton S. Hershey did. In one of the biggest philanthropic gestures of the century, Milton S. Hershey and his wife Catherine, who could have no children of their own, founded a residential school for children in need.
Milton, preceded in death by his wife, left his fortune to the School, which has been in existence for nearly 100 years.
Today, the Milton Hershey School, serving 1,400 children from across the country, continues to grow. It provides a home, food, clothing, medical care, and a quality education at no cost and they are looking for more children to take advantage of this great opportunity.
